When people talk about Tabor Academy, one of the first things that often comes up is its deep connection to the sea. This isn't just a casual link; it's woven into the very fabric of daily life there, you know. A big part of this unique identity comes from the school's very own sailing and research ship, the Tabor Boy. This impressive vessel, which measures 92 feet, isn't just for show; it's a floating classroom, a place where students truly get their hands dirty and learn in ways that go far beyond what you might expect from a typical classroom setting. It’s almost like a living, breathing part of the campus, really, offering experiences that shape young people in profound ways.

Working with a ship of that considerable size, well, it certainly calls for a particular kind of readiness from everyone involved. There’s a lot that goes into handling such a craft, and it asks those on board to be quite adaptable in their thinking, you see. It also means that working together with others becomes absolutely essential, as everyone needs to pull their weight for things to go smoothly. And, as a matter of fact, maintaining a cheerful and positive outlook on things, even when challenges pop up, is something that truly helps everyone on the crew. This kind of practical, hands-on learning, it builds character in a way that’s pretty remarkable.

Beyond the excitement of the open water, Tabor Academy also puts a lot of thought into how it shares information about its students with colleges. They send out a document with each application, which is a chart showing how grades are distributed for every course, each semester. This chart, you might say, basically gives colleges a very clear picture of how each student who takes a particular class performs compared to their peers. It's a way for colleges to get a very honest look at a student's academic journey, which is pretty helpful, don't you think?

How Does Tabor Academy Support Student Learning?

Tabor Academy goes to some lengths to provide a clear picture of its students' academic progress to colleges. They send along a special sheet with each college application. This sheet is a grade distribution chart for every single course offered, and it breaks things down by each semester. This means that when a college admissions office looks at an application, they get a very complete picture of how a student has performed, and how that performance fits within the larger group of students taking the same class. It’s a pretty open way of sharing academic information, which, you know, can be very helpful for everyone involved in the college application process.

This approach to sharing academic data is quite thoughtful, you might say. It allows colleges to see, very simply, what each student who takes a particular class achieves. This level of detail can help colleges make more informed decisions, giving them a good sense of a student’s academic background and their place within the school’s learning environment. It’s a way of making sure that a student’s hard work is truly seen and understood, which is something that can really make a difference for young people applying to higher education.

Getting Help at the Academic Resource Center at Tabor Academy

The Academic Resource Center at Tabor Academy, affectionately known as the ARC, is a very important part of the school's support system. This center is open to every student at Tabor, no matter what their academic strengths or challenges might be. It’s a place where students can go if they want to improve their study habits, get better at writing, or perhaps just understand a difficult subject a little more clearly. This kind of support, you know, can be incredibly helpful for young people as they move through their academic years.

The purpose of the ARC is quite straightforward: it's there to help students develop or refine their academic skills. This could mean anything from learning how to organize their notes more effectively to getting one-on-one help with a specific math problem. The existence of such a center truly shows that Tabor Academy is committed to helping all its students succeed, giving them the tools and assistance they need to reach their full potential. It’s a very practical way of showing care for student progress, which is something that parents and students often look for in a school, basically.
